Crash Location P-38 Lightning

This memorial and wreck commemorate the crash of a P-38 Lightning, flown by 2nd Lt. Max P. Clark, which went down during a gunnery training flight on 9 February 1945.

The exact location of the site is not known and can be asked for at the Bureau of Land Management Lake County.
